Juancho has no children, but he has two brothers, One of them is Willie Hernángómez, whom he considers an inspiration, they both play in the NBA and exchange projects, such as a training camp for children and youth in Madrid, that they teach during the professional championship break. His roots have been associated with this sport since his birth, his mother Margarita Goyer and his father Guillermo Hernangomez are prominent in Spanish basketball. Today, the three sons honor this legacy.

Had it not been for the Covid pandemic that has halted all sporting activities in the world, and in this case, Juancho’s routine, acting would never have entered his resume, despite the fact that his agent had previously insisted on it. I was in quarantine at my brother’s house and I was so bored. It was my sister who pushed me to the test. That’s the only good thing the pandemic has brought.”said to diverse. Anyone thought to make a movie with Adam Sandler It’s an honor to be recognized and accepted by everyone at first, but the basketball player was honest about it because even though he forged a great friendship with the Hollywood actor from filming, prior to this experience he wasn’t exactly a fan of his movies. .

Even now that he’s reaped the benefits of media exposure, Juancho has kept his head in the game and was surprised when he revealed, in an interview with slash movie That the film itself is not his greatest pride in this aspect as an actor: “Yeah, I’m prouder of LeBron knowing who I am and giving me a hug more than I am in the whole movie, to be honest with you. I have a picture with LeBron and sent it to Adam. LeBron to me is like Michael Jordan. I grew up watching it, so he came to a game and was like, “Hey, thanks for making the movie, you’re doing a great job!” I came home like, “Man, LeBron knows my name!”

with the phrase “Okay, nothing, now I’m an actor…” Juancho Hernangómez showed his new face on Twitter, back in May when they released the trailer, and while he doesn’t close the possibility of continuing in that career, his goal is basketball. However, his illustrious present on the cinematic level, being one of the most watched films on Netflix in recent months, contrasts with the uncertainty of his sports career. In the previous season he was transferred four times (Timberwolves, Grizzlies, Celtics, Spurs and Jazz), the latter ending his contract at the end of June and leaving him looking for a team for the next team starting in October.
